  • Abstract
    In this paper, digital forms of the quadricorrelator, which is an ideal frequency detector, are presented. The proposed circuits consist of conventional digital logic devices without analog elements. Therefore, they have superior reliability in respect of component drift and aging effects. The frequency linear discrimination range can be adjusted from ±20% to ±100% with simple modifications
